| commit | 636fefe25260e5a62f048d5c24d28dbf8596ad9e | [log] [tgz] |
|---|---|---|
| author | Vladimir Medic <Vladimir.Medic@imgtec.com> | Wed Dec 17 11:49:56 2014 +0000 |
| committer | Vladimir Medic <Vladimir.Medic@imgtec.com> | Wed Dec 17 11:49:56 2014 +0000 |
| tree | da6783d2aca91e29e1f5000b6179f0fd5834bd75 | |
| parent | af92a37c23fae4c16c9d5fb7724c70efaf63f7ff [diff] |
MipsABIInfo class is used in different libraries. Moving the files to MCTargetDesc folder(LLVMMipsDesc library) prevents linkage errors. There are no functional changes. llvm-svn: 224427
diff --git a/llvm/lib/Target/Mips/CMakeLists.txt b/llvm/lib/Target/Mips/CMakeLists.txt index 1f201b0..36ba8e5 100644 --- a/llvm/lib/Target/Mips/CMakeLists.txt +++ b/llvm/lib/Target/Mips/CMakeLists.txt
@@ -21,7 +21,6 @@ Mips16ISelDAGToDAG.cpp Mips16ISelLowering.cpp Mips16RegisterInfo.cpp - MipsABIInfo.cpp MipsAnalyzeImmediate.cpp MipsAsmPrinter.cpp MipsCCState.cpp
diff --git a/llvm/lib/Target/Mips/MCTargetDesc/CMakeLists.txt b/llvm/lib/Target/Mips/MCTargetDesc/CMakeLists.txt index 6b3788c..c63af7c 100644 --- a/llvm/lib/Target/Mips/MCTargetDesc/CMakeLists.txt +++ b/llvm/lib/Target/Mips/MCTargetDesc/CMakeLists.txt
@@ -1,4 +1,5 @@ add_llvm_library(LLVMMipsDesc + MipsABIInfo.cpp MipsABIFlagsSection.cpp MipsAsmBackend.cpp MipsELFObjectWriter.cpp
diff --git a/llvm/lib/Target/Mips/MipsABIInfo.cpp b/llvm/lib/Target/Mips/MCTargetDesc/MipsABIInfo.cpp similarity index 100% rename from llvm/lib/Target/Mips/MipsABIInfo.cpp rename to llvm/lib/Target/Mips/MCTargetDesc/MipsABIInfo.cpp
diff --git a/llvm/lib/Target/Mips/MipsABIInfo.h b/llvm/lib/Target/Mips/MCTargetDesc/MipsABIInfo.h similarity index 100% rename from llvm/lib/Target/Mips/MipsABIInfo.h rename to llvm/lib/Target/Mips/MCTargetDesc/MipsABIInfo.h
diff --git a/llvm/lib/Target/Mips/MipsSubtarget.h b/llvm/lib/Target/Mips/MipsSubtarget.h index bff9013..9d426d1 100644 --- a/llvm/lib/Target/Mips/MipsSubtarget.h +++ b/llvm/lib/Target/Mips/MipsSubtarget.h
@@ -22,7 +22,7 @@ #include "llvm/MC/MCInstrItineraries.h" #include "llvm/Support/ErrorHandling.h" #include "llvm/Target/TargetSubtargetInfo.h" -#include "MipsABIInfo.h" +#include "MCTargetDesc/MipsABIInfo.h" #include <string> #define GET_SUBTARGETINFO_HEADER